Job description

Job Description

We’re looking for a proactive and organised Team Leader to oversee our day-to-day production activities, ensuring smooth processes, high performance, and a safe working environment.

About the Role

As a key member of our operations team, you’ll manage a team of Operators and coordinate valve production to meet customer demand, backlog requirements, and quality standards. You’ll work closely with Planning and Purchasing teams to ensure parts are delivered on time, enabling your team to keep production flowing efficiently.

This is a hands‑on, fast‑paced role where you’ll lead by example, maintain high standards, and drive continuous improvement across your area.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ead, develop, and motivate a team of Operators to achieve daily performance targets.
  • Coordinate production activities in line with customer demand and backlog.
  • Work collaboratively with internal Planning and Purchasing teams to ensure timely parts availability.
  • Maintain accurate build and test instructions, ensuring internal processes run smoothly.
  • Use data‑driven insights to support decision‑making, including daily SQDCP reporting.
  • Actively participate in tier meetings, contributing to problem‑solving and process improvements.
  • Uphold 5S housekeeping standards and promote an organised, efficient work environment.
  • Implement efficiency improvements and address design, infrastructure, or process‑related issues.
  • Ensure all safety protocols are followed and maintain a safe working environment.
  • Collaborate with other Team Leaders and the Health & Safety Manager to address safety needs.
  • Remain adaptable as responsibilities develop alongside business needs.

Additional Information

Rotork is the market‑leading global flow control and instrumentation company, helping our customers manage the flow of liquids, gases and powders across many industries worldwide.

Our purpose is Keeping the World Flowing for Future Generations.

For over sixty years, the world has relied on us to create the things that keep everything moving. From oil and gas to water and shipping, pharmaceuticals and food—these are the flows on which our modern world depends.

Today we're respected and admired for our people, performance and products. Our success flows from our commitment to engineering excellence, and that's what we will always pursue, safely and sustainably.
